NEW DELHI: The Karnataka Examinations Authority (KEA) has issued a notification for candidates who have failed to make payments for UGCET 2024 applications and candidates who have not selected CET in combined application. The examination authority has asked such candidates to personally be present in KEA from April 10 to 12 till 5 pm and submit application.
"Apply for UGCET-24, a golden opportunity for those who have not opted for CET. Many had appealed to KEA that they took only NEET and did not take CET to go for engineering. Such people are allowed from humanitarian point of view. Must come to KEA before 12th and apply" KEA said on 'X'.
The KCET 2024 exam is scheduled to be held on April 18, 19. The KCET 2024 admit card has been made available on the official website, cetonline.karnataka.gov.in. "At this stage some of the candidates have approached KEA requesting an opportunity as they have missed to make payments or to select CET exam in combined application and that this has come to their notice while downloading hall tickets", KEA notice added
Candidates who have failed to pay application fees should personally be present in KEA from April 10 to 12 till 5 pm and submit DD for Rs 600 drawn in favour of Executive Director, KEA, Bangalore. Candidates should also bring a copy of their applications.
Examination centre to be granted as per availability
According to KEA all exam preparations are finished, applicants at this point will be assigned to an available seat at an examination center anywhere in Karnataka. Only candidates who agree to this condition will be taken into consideration.
Candidates can use their login credentials such as registration number and date of birth to download the KCET admit card 2024. The KCET 2024 will be held at 54 examination centres across 29 districts in Karnataka. The exam is expected to attract around 2.5 lakh students.
